## Deployment: upgrading the broker

Fenwick Relay 4.x changes the wire protocol. Plugins built against 3.x will not reconnect after the upgrade; rebuild against the new SDK first. Upgrade order: drain consumers, stop producers, upgrade broker nodes one at a time, then restart plugins. Do not skip the drain step — in-flight messages on 3.x nodes are dropped by 4.x replicas. Rollback is supported within 24 hours only. After upgrading, set the broker to the following values.

settings of yahag-yafog:
[pramir]
host = pramir.qirvancorp.internal
user = pramir_svc
database = pramir_prod

# GarageFeed Environments

GarageFeed publishes occupancy counts for the Delmora Parking structures every 30 seconds. Three environments: dev, staging, prod. Staging mirrors prod sensor traffic at 10% sample rate; dev uses synthetic counts only. Promotion order is dev → staging → prod, gated by the release manager. Prod deploys freeze during the Harborfest weekend. Before cutting a release, confirm the active values below match the release sheet.

settings of bawif-fawif:
ralix:
  log_level: warn
  metrics_host: metrics.ralix.tolvaqsys.internal
  pool_size: 32

## Formula sandbox tuning

User-supplied formulas in Gridmoor execute inside a restricted interpreter with hard ceilings on time, memory, and call depth. Reviewers should confirm any change to these ceilings is justified in the PR description, since raising them widens the abuse surface. Defaults were chosen from production traces. The current limits are as follows.

limits module of tafog-fawip:
WEIGHTS = {
    "julix": 57,
    "lamys": 992,
    "kasvan": 209,
    "quenok": 750,
    "alddor": 259,
    "oliath": 1009,
    "wenix": 815,
}

HANDOVER NOTE — Nightwell backfill scheduler

Passing Nightwell maintenance from me to Ilka. Plugin authors: nightly backfills queue at 02:00 local to the Harrowden cluster, and plugins must declare idempotent windows or the scheduler skips them. The plugin registry was recently re-keyed, so existing tokens are invalid. To re-register your plugin, unlock the registry with the recovery passphrase below.

recovery phrase for bawif-yawif: gorwyn-kelix-zorox-silath-novix-juleth